"A short and very scenic route, ideal for families, with children, or even pets. It's about 3 km long and runs mostly alongside the river canyon, with spectacular views of the vertical walls and several waterfalls that make the walk a truly visual experience.
The elevation gain is minimal, although there are some gentle slopes. It's not demanding, but appropriate footwear is recommended. Perfect for enjoying nature without having to hike for long periods.
Highly recommended if you're in the Sierra de Cazorla area."

🎫 🏞️ Onsite Experience

The main circular route is considered easy, approximately 2-3 km long, with minimal elevation gain, making it suitable for families and less experienced hikers. InstagramReddit

The main circular trail can be completed in about 1 to 1.5 hours, allowing time for stops to admire the views and waterfalls. Reddit

Yes, pets are generally allowed on the trail, but it's important to keep them on a leash and clean up after them to preserve the natural environment. Reddit

Expect dramatic gorge landscapes, vertical rock walls, and beautiful waterfalls, including the notable Cola de Caballo and Linarejos waterfalls. InstagramReddit+1

The main path is relatively easy, but due to some uneven terrain and gentle slopes, it might be challenging for strollers or wheelchairs. A carrier might be more suitable for very young children. Reddit

The Geology and Hydrology of Cerrada de Utrero

Cerrada de Utrero is a stunning example of a river gorge carved over millennia by the erosive power of water. The Río Guadalquivir, Spain's fourth-longest river, flows through this dramatic landscape, shaping its unique geological features. The limestone rock formations are characteristic of the Sierra de Cazorla, allowing water to carve out narrow passages and create impressive vertical walls. The presence of several waterfalls, most notably the Cascada Cola de Caballo and the Linarejos waterfall, is a testament to the ongoing geological processes at play. These cascades are particularly impressive after periods of heavy rainfall, as seen in some dramatic footage. Instagram

The hydrology of the area is dynamic. While the river can be a gentle flow during drier months, it can transform into a powerful force during wetter seasons, as evidenced by past flash floods. This variability is part of what makes the gorge so captivating. Visitors can observe how the water has sculpted the rock, creating smooth channels and dramatic drops. The surrounding vegetation thrives in this moist environment, adding to the scenic beauty of the gorge. Instagram

Understanding the geological history helps appreciate the raw beauty of Cerrada de Utrero. It's a living landscape, constantly shaped by natural forces. For those interested in geology, the distinct layers of rock and the sheer scale of the gorge offer a fascinating glimpse into Earth's processes. The accessibility of the main trail allows many to witness these natural wonders firsthand without needing extensive hiking experience. Reddit

Activities and Adventure in Cerrada de Utrero

While the main trail offers a beautiful and accessible walk, Cerrada de Utrero is also a popular spot for more adventurous activities. Canyoning is a prime example, with guided tours available that allow participants to navigate the gorge's natural water slides, jumps, and rappels. These experiences are often described as thrilling and a unique way to explore the hidden corners of the canyon. Instagram+1

For hikers looking to extend their journey, there's an option to venture towards the old power plant. This path is described as more challenging, involving a significant gradient on the return trip. It offers a different perspective of the river and the surrounding landscape, rewarding those who seek a bit more exertion. Reddit The Río Guadalquivir itself is a central element, and experiencing its flow through the gorge is a key part of the adventure. Instagram
